Control panels

The control panel is the heart of the alarm system. The control panel is an electronic circuit board that provides power to all system components and makes decisions about the operation of the system. The circuit board is enclosed in a metal cabinet which also contains the backup battery and serves as the central connection point for the cables that run to the security devices.

The control panel circuit board includes a microprocessor, memory, and data storage components that essentially make up a small, specialized computer. This computer takes commands from you through the alarm keypad, watches the condition of the intrusion sensors and makes decisions about when it is necessary to sound the alarm, call the police, etc.

Alarm control panels have become very sophisticated in recent years and even the most basic models are now capable of many advanced functions such as;

  • Determining whether or not a homeowner is "at home" or "away"
  • Tracking who is coming and going from a business premise
  • Automatically arming at a certain time of day
  • Performing constant self-tests to determine that major system components are working correctly.

The alarm control panel is the most important component you will purchase. The selection of the alarm control panel determines the system capabilities in all regards. There are a huge variety of systems on the market and with a few exceptions most alarm panels are well built and have an incredible number of features. A key feature of any control panel is the number of zones inputs available (a "zone" is an input for connecting sensors). Another critical feature is the design of the "user interface", the way in which you give the system commands and receive information from the keypad. A system which is too simple may not have all of the features that you require, while a system that is too complex may be difficult for you to operate.
